TAL Education (TAL) shares rose around 1.5% in late Friday trading as brokerages raised price target of the after-school education firm after an upbeat third-quarter results.
Morgan Stanley lifted price target of the stock to $16 from $14.60 and maintained its overweight rating. While Macquarie upgraded the company to outperform from neutral and raised price target to $18 from $13.10.
Trading volume stood at over 7.3 million shares compared with a daily average of about 3.4 million shares.
TAL Education posted late Thursday higher fiscal Q3 adjusted earnings that beat expectations and net revenue that rose from a year ago.
